Cruiser Avrora anchored on the Neva River. The ship fired the historical shot that signalled the assault on the Winter Palace in St. Petersburg in 1917. Having been docked forever in 1948, Avrora was converted to a museum ship in 1956, thus becoming a branch of the Central Navy Museum.
